77
78    /// Returns the store for the current tenant, creating if needed.
79    async fn get_store(&self) -> A2aResult<Arc<InMemoryPushConfigStore>> {
80        let tenant = TenantContext::current();
81
82        {
83            let stores = self.stores.read().await;
84            if let Some(store) = stores.get(&tenant) {
85                return Ok(Arc::clone(store));
86            }
87        }
88
89        let mut stores = self.stores.write().await;
90        if let Some(store) = stores.get(&tenant) {
91            return Ok(Arc::clone(store));
92        }
93
94        if stores.len() >= self.max_tenants {
95            return Err(a2a_protocol_types::error::A2aError::internal(format!(
96                "tenant limit exceeded: max {} tenants",
97                self.max_tenants
98            )));
99        }
100
101        let store = Arc::new(InMemoryPushConfigStore::with_max_configs_per_task(
102            self.max_configs_per_task,
103        ));
104        stores.insert(tenant, Arc::clone(&store));
105        drop(stores);
106        Ok(store)
107    }
108
109    /// Returns the store for the current tenant **without** creating one.
110    ///
111    /// Read-only operations (`get`/`list`/`delete`) must not allocate a tenant
112    /// partition: doing so lets an attacker exhaust the `max_tenants` budget (and
113    /// grow memory) by issuing reads for many never-seen tenant names, after
114    /// which legitimate *new* tenants' writes fail with "tenant limit exceeded".
115    async fn get_existing_store(&self) -> Option<Arc<InMemoryPushConfigStore>> {
116        let tenant = TenantContext::current();
117        self.stores.read().await.get(&tenant).map(Arc::clone)
118    }
119
120    /// Returns the number of active tenant partitions.
121    pub async fn tenant_count(&self) -> usize {
122        self.stores.read().await.len()
123    }
124}
